In Typee and Omoo, Herman Melville transforms his Pacific experiences into vivid narratives of captivity, wandering, and cultural encounter. Typee recounts a sailor's uneasy sojourn among the Marquesans, while Omoo follows maritime desertion and island life in Tahiti. Blending travel writing, romance, ethnography, satire, and adventure, the books stand at the threshold of American literary modernity, challenging imperial certainties while indulging the era's fascination with the "exotic." Melville's authority derives from lived experience: as a young sailor he shipped on whalers, deserted, and moved through the South Seas before returning to America. These early voyages shaped his imagination and supplied the material for his first literary successes. Yet Melville was never merely a recorder of incident; he used autobiography to test assumptions about civilization, religion, commerce, and freedom.
